Technical Problem

Existing cable trench covers are inconvenient to open and close, lack adequate ventilation, and have insufficient structural strength, making them susceptible to damage and wear from the external environment.

Method used

A ventilated hydraulic cable trench cover device was designed, comprising a protective outer frame, hydraulic support rods, and a support frame. The cover is stably supported and released by the extension and retraction of the hydraulic support rods. Combined with ventilation holes and the support frame to distribute pressure, it provides a stable boundary and convenient opening and closing.

Benefits of technology

The operation and safety of cable trench covers have been improved, preventing external objects or personnel from accidentally entering, reducing the risk of cable damage, ensuring ventilation and protection in the cable trench, and extending the service life of the covers.

Abstract

The utility model relates to the technical field of cable trench cover plates, in particular to a ventilation type hydraulic cable trench cover plate device. Comprising a protective outer frame and a cable trench cover plate, one end of the cover plate is hinged to the outer frame, and a supporting part is arranged in the outer frame to support the opened cover plate. The supporting part is composed of a first connector, a second connector and a hydraulic supporting rod, and stable supporting and easy releasing of the cover plate are achieved. A supporting frame is arranged on the inner surface of the cover plate to disperse pressure, meanwhile, the structural strength and safety of the cover plate are improved, the protective outer frame comprises an outer frame and a protective plate, and ventilation holes are formed in the protective plate to promote air exchange. The cover plate is connected with the outer frame through hinges, and flexible opening and closing are facilitated. According to the utility model, through the hydraulic supporting rod, the cable trench cover plate can be opened and closed easily and can be supported when a cable trench needs to be ventilated. According to the ventilation type hydraulic cable trench cover plate device, the operation convenience of opening and closing the cover plate is improved, and the ventilation effect is improved.

Description

TECHNICAL FIELD

[0001] The utility model relates to cable trench cover plate technical field, concretely relates to a ventilated hydraulic cable trench cover plate device. BACKGROUND

[0002] The cable trench is a kind of underground pipeline for laying and replacing power or telecommunication cable facilities, and is also the enclosure structure of the laid cable facilities.The trench body is used to accommodate the cable, and the cover plate is used to close the trench body and protect the cable from external damage.

[0003] The existing cable trench cover plate is mostly opened and closed by manual carrying mode.Especially when the cable trench cover plate needs to be frequently opened and closed for ventilation and airing or maintenance, the manual carrying mode is particularly inconvenient and inefficient, and there is no protective measure when ventilation and airing, so it is easy to be disturbed by external environment, such as rodents gnawing cable, which threatens the stable operation of power system;Since the cable trench cover plate is usually located under the road or pedestrian passageway, it is often stepped on by pedestrians and vehicles.The traditional cable trench cover plate usually only uses a cover plate to cover the cable trench, which cannot withstand long-term heavy pressure and wear and tear, resulting in deformation, cracking and even damage of the cover plate. [0025] Example 1

[0026] like Figures 1-4 As shown, this embodiment provides a ventilated hydraulic cable trench cover device, which includes: a protective outer frame 100, and a cable trench cover 200 covering the protective outer frame 100; one end of the cable trench cover 200 is hinged to the protective outer frame 100; support portions 300 for supporting the cable trench cover 200 when it is in the open state are provided at the upper and lower ends of the inner surface of the protective outer frame 100.

[0027] In this embodiment, the protective frame 100 provides a stable boundary for the cable trench, effectively preventing external objects or personnel from accidentally entering the trench and causing potential damage to the cables. Simultaneously, the protective frame 100 also provides a supporting foundation for the cable trench cover 200, ensuring stable installation of the cover.

[0028] In this embodiment, the cable trench cover 200 covers the protective frame 100, protecting the cables from external environmental damage such as rain and dust. Meanwhile, the support 300 is designed for easy opening and closing, facilitating ventilation and sun drying in the cable trench.

[0029] In this embodiment, the support part 300 includes a first connector 310 with one end fixedly connected to the inner surface of the cable trench cover plate 200 near the protective outer frame 100, a second connector 320 with the other end fixedly connected to the inner surface of the protective outer frame 100 away from the protective outer frame 100, and a hydraulic support rod 330 with both ends movably connected to the first connector 310 and the second connector 320 respectively.

[0030] Through the reasonable position relationship between the first joint 310 and the second joint 320 in the embodiment, the hydraulic support rod 330 can be extended or retracted when needed, so as to realize the support or release of the cover plate. The hydraulic support rod 330 also enables the cover plate to be stable in the open state and not to sway due to external factors such as wind, thereby improving the safety.

[0031] In the embodiment, the inner surface of the cable trench cover plate 200 is provided with a support frame 210 for covering the inner surface of the protective outer frame 100 when the cable trench cover plate 200 is closed.

[0032] In the embodiment, the support frame 210 is arranged on the inner surface of the cable trench cover plate 200 and is used to cover the bottom of the mounting cavity when the cover plate is closed. The design of the support frame 210 can effectively disperse the pressure of the cover plate on the cable trench bottom and prevent the cable trench from being damaged due to excessive local pressure.

[0033] In the embodiment, the protective outer frame 100 includes an outer frame 110 and a protective plate 120 arranged in the outer frame 110, and the outer frame 110 and the protective plate 120 jointly constitute a mounting space 130 for closing the cable trench cover plate 200.

[0034] In the embodiment, the outer frame 110 constitutes the basic framework of the protective outer frame 100 and provides stable support for the protective plate 120.

[0035] In the embodiment, the protective plate 120 is provided with a ventilation hole 121.

[0036] In the embodiment, the ventilation hole 121 is arranged on the protective plate 120, so that the cable trench can exchange air with the outside, effectively reducing the humidity and temperature inside the cable trench, and preventing the cable from being damaged due to moisture or overheating.

[0037] In the embodiment, the side of the cable trench cover plate 200 close to the first joint 310 is connected to the inner wall of the side of the outer frame 110 close to the first joint 310 through a hinge 140.

[0038] In the embodiment, the side of the cable trench cover plate 200 close to the first joint 310 is connected to the inner wall of the side of the outer frame 110 close to the first joint 310 through a hinge 140, so that the cover plate can be easily and flexibly opened and closed, reducing the labor intensity of the operator, and the hinge 140 connection can also reduce the impact and noise of the cover plate during opening and closing to a certain extent.

[0039] In the embodiment, a handle slot 220 is formed on one side of the outer surface of the cable trench cover plate 200, and a handle 230 is rotatably installed in the handle slot 220.

[0040] By the handle groove 220 in this embodiment is opened in the outer surface side of the cable trench cover plate 200, the handle 230 is rotatably installed inside. The handle 230 is designed so that the operator can more conveniently open and close the cable trench cover plate 200, improving the convenience of operation.

[0041] The ventilation type hydraulic cable trench cover plate 200 device of the present embodiment is used when the cable trench cover plate 200 needs to be opened for ventilation and airing. The operator first applies an outward force to pull open the cable trench cover plate 200. At this time, the hydraulic support rod 330 begins to work, and its internal hydraulic system automatically responds to this external force. As the cover plate is gradually opened, the hydraulic support rod 330 gradually extends until it fully supports the cable trench cover plate 200. The hydraulic support rod 330 provides the necessary support force, allowing the cable trench cover plate 200 to hang smoothly and safely above the cable trench, avoiding sudden falling due to gravity. When the ventilation and airing or maintenance work is completed, the operator needs to close the cable trench cover plate 200. At this time, it only needs to gently push the cover plate to move it towards the protective outer frame 100. As the cover plate gradually approaches the protective outer frame 100, the hydraulic support rod 330 begins to automatically retract. Its internal hydraulic system automatically adjusts the size and direction of the support force according to the movement speed and position of the cable trench cover plate 200, ensuring that the cover plate can be closed smoothly and smoothly. When the cable trench cover plate 200 is completely closed on the protective outer frame 100, the hydraulic support rod 330 is completely retracted to the initial position and no longer exerts any support force on the cable trench cover plate 200.
